Did You Know

The reason rebonded and straightened hair frizzes is not simply humidity; it is porosity. When the hair's disulphide bonds are chemically broken and reformed during the straightening process, the cuticle layer is disrupted and the internal structure of the hair shaft becomes more porous. This increased porosity means the hair absorbs moisture from the surrounding air unevenly and rapidly, causing the shaft to swell in unpredictable directions and the straight alignment of the hair to be disrupted. Sealing the cuticle after every wash is the most effective way to manage this: a smooth, sealed cuticle surface reduces the rate at which moisture enters the shaft, keeping the hair's straight structure aligned and the surface sleek. Nourish Weakened Strands

Avocado Oil & Pro Vitamin B5

Avocado Oil (Persea americana) and Pro-Vitamin B5 (Panthenol) are the hero nourishing ingredients in the Craft Rebond System range, chosen for the specific and complementary roles they play in supporting hair that has been structurally altered by chemical straightening or heat processing. Avocado Oil is rich in oleic acid, linoleic acid, and fat-soluble Vitamins A, D, and E, and unlike heavier botanical oils that sit on the hair surface, it is small enough in molecular structure to partially penetrate the cortex, delivering nourishment inside the shaft where chemical processing has caused the most depletion. Panthenol builds on this by improving the hair's moisture retention and elasticity from within, helping chemically treated strands become more resilient and less prone to the brittleness and breakage that repeated heat styling and straightening compounds over time. Together, they address the internal condition of straightened hair, not just the surface appearance.
